Blueberry Festival



This morning, we went to a Blueberry Festival at Roper Mountain Science Center. There were booths of delicious treats, blueberry-themed games and crafts at the Living History Farm, and the Natural Sciences building was open to the public, featuring lots of exhibits, animals, and educational displays. It was summer at its best, with live music, freshly baked pies & farmers' market stands, and of course the abundant blueberries everywhere = yummy! We all enjoyed the festival, but Luke's favorite part by far was the "city bus" (shuttle ride from the parking lot to the festival). He could have ridden the bus all day long and been perfectly happy. Here are some pictures from our day:
